Country Singer Jelly Roll Shed 100 Pounds: Wait Till You See How He Looks Now

Jelly Roll, the 39-year-old country singer and rapper famous for “Somebody Save Me,” has amazed fans with his health transformation, shedding over 100 pounds. Guided by his personal chef, Ian Larios, Jelly Roll’s journey includes a disciplined diet and intense workouts like basketball, boxing, and stair-climbing while on his “Beautifully Broken” tour. His pre-show snack is a healthy mix of bananas, honey, and dark chocolate for an energy boost.

Jelly Roll recently celebrated completing a 5K, marking significant progress since he began his fitness journey. Despite facing public scrutiny, he’s stayed motivated, supported by fans and family. Alongside a booming music career, with accolades at the iHeartRadio and CMT Music Awards, Jelly Roll’s transformation is inspiring fans, proving it’s never too late to pursue health.
